Что вы используете для пересылки ошибок в файл?

Что вы используете для пересылки ошибок в файл в Linux?

Как в Linux перенаправлять сообщения об ошибках? Стандартная ошибка (также известная как stderr) - устройство вывода ошибок по умолчанию. Используйте stderr для написания всех сообщений об ошибках системы. Число (FD - File Descriptors) два (2) обозначает stderr.

Как перенаправить вывод и ошибку в файл в Linux?

Синтаксис перенаправления вывода (stdout) следующий:

  1. имя-команды> output.txt имя-команды> stdout.txt.
  2. имя-команды 2> errors.txt имя-команды 2> stderr.txt.
  3. команда1> out.txt 2> err.txt команда2 -f -z -y> out.txt 2> err.txt.
  4. команда1> все.txt 2> & 1 команда1 -арг> все.txt 2> & 1.

Как перенаправить вывод в файл?

Список:

  1. команда> output.txt. Стандартный поток вывода будет перенаправлен только в файл, он не будет виден в терминале. ...
  2. команда >> output.txt. ...
  3. команда 2> output.txt. ...
  4. команда 2 >> output.txt. ...
  5. команда &> output.txt. ...
  6. команда & >> output.txt. ...
  7. команда | тройник output.txt. ...
  8. команда | тройник -a output.txt.

Какая команда используется для перенаправления и добавления вывода в файл?

Любой файловый дескриптор может быть перенаправлен на другой файловый дескриптор или файл с помощью оператор> или >> (добавить).

Как перенаправить файл в Linux?

Резюме

  1. С каждым файлом в Linux связан соответствующий файловый дескриптор.
  2. Клавиатура является стандартным устройством ввода, а экран - стандартным устройством вывода.
  3. «>» - это оператор перенаправления вывода. «>>» ...
  4. «<» - это оператор перенаправления ввода.
  5. «> &» Перенаправляет вывод одного файла в другой.

Как перенаправить содержимое файла в Linux?

Чтобы использовать перенаправление bash, вы запускаете команду, указываете > или >> оператор, а затем укажите путь к файлу, в который вы хотите перенаправить вывод. > перенаправляет вывод команды в файл, заменяя существующее содержимое файла.

Как перенаправить ошибку и вывод в файл?

2 ответа

  1. Перенаправить stdout в один файл и stderr в другой файл: command> out 2> error.
  2. Перенаправить stdout в файл (> out), а затем перенаправить stderr на stdout (2> & 1): command> out 2> & 1.

Как вы можете добавить сообщение об ошибке в файл команды?

Использовать команда >> file_to_append_to добавить в файл. ВНИМАНИЕ: если вы используете только один>, вы перезапишете содержимое файла. Чтобы этого никогда не произошло, вы можете добавить set -o noclobber в свой.

Stderr - это файл?

Stderr, также известный как стандартная ошибка, дескриптор файла по умолчанию, в который процесс может писать сообщения об ошибках. В Unix-подобных операционных системах, таких как Linux, macOS X и BSD, stderr определяется стандартом POSIX. Его номер дескриптора файла по умолчанию - 2. В терминале стандартная ошибка по умолчанию отображается на экране пользователя.

Как сохранить вывод консоли Writeline в текстовый файл?

app.exe >> output.txt

Этот код будет выводиться как в консоль, так и в строку журнала, которую можно сохранить в файл, либо добавив к нему строки, либо перезаписав его. Имя по умолчанию для файла журнала - «Журнал. txt 'и сохраняется в пути к приложению.

Какая команда принимает стандартный вывод в качестве ввода и отправляет его на принтер?

В кошачья утилита представляет собой хороший пример того, как клавиатура и экран работают как стандартный ввод и стандартный вывод соответственно. Когда вы запускаете cat, он копирует файл на стандартный вывод. Поскольку оболочка направляет стандартный вывод на экран, cat отображает файл на экране.

Как добавить текст в файл?

4 ответа. По сути, вы можете выгрузить в файл любой текст, который хотите. CTRL-D отправляет сигнал конца файла, который завершает ввод и возвращает вас в оболочку. С использованием оператор >> добавит данные в конец файла, а использование> перезапишет содержимое файла, если он уже существует.

Как мне добавить в файл?

Итак, чтобы добавить в файл, это так же просто, как: f = open ('имя_файла. txt ',' a ') f. записывать('все, что вы хотите написать здесь (в режиме добавления) сюда.

Какая команда позволяет изменить групповое владение файлом?

Измените владельца группы файла с помощью команда chgrp. Задает имя группы или GID новой группы файла или каталога.

Интересные материалы:

Как мне узнать свое местоположение на устройствах Google?
Как мне узнать свой идентификатор магазина Google Play?
Как мне вернуть деньги в Google?
Как мне вернуть деньги за платеж Google?
Как мне вернуть Google на свой планшет?
Как мне вернуть Google в нормальное состояние?
Как мне вернуть свою учетную запись Google после сброса настроек?
Как мне вернуться на старую главную страницу Google?
Как мне войти в свою учетную запись Google на BlueStacks?
Как мне войти в свою учетную запись Google на планшете Android?